OPINION
DAVIS, Commissioner.
Appeal is taken from an order revoking probation.
On original submission, appellant's court-appointed counsel filed a brief which set forth no contentions. The record did not reflect that appellant was served with counsel's brief, that appellant was given an opportunity to examine the appellate record, or that appellant was advised of his right to file a pro se brief and given an opportunity to do so.
